Vinnie Colaiuta created a very unique odd meter groove for Sting's song "seven days". Even though the song might let you expect a song in 7/8, the song is actually in 5/8, what's even rarer.
Besides the main groove itself, the song is packed with small little fills that make it super fun to check out and play on drums. If you've ever wondered what exactly Colaiuta is playing here: worry no more - Chris Hoffmann is here to tell you.
